About Oregon School For The Deaf
-
Oregon School For The Deaf is located in Salem, OR and is one of 4 schools in Oregon Department Of Education. It is a special education school that serves 40 students in grades K-12.
Special Education schools are public schools that provide special services for children with disabilities (special physical, mental, or learning needs). Many special education schools also provide vocational training, adapted physical education, and assistive technology for their students.
In 2006, Oregon School For The Deaf had 2 students for every full-time equivalent teacher. The Oregon average is 21 students per full-time equivalent teacher. Learn more about Oregon School For The Deaf's students and teachers.
